Output d4e40ae046faacfe6db49e83f8753e1794eefb0a599e8addfbb307f0258e41e3:0

value
594310248
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 669ea48cd646e192dac4ecbf2aa8d1d399f84c0cefd8473f9d76b2fd3c4317ef
address
tb1pv602frxkgmse9kkyajlj42x36wvlsnqvalvyw0uaw6e060zrzlhsemnndz
transaction
d4e40ae046faacfe6db49e83f8753e1794eefb0a599e8addfbb307f0258e41e3